Most vets, shelters, and rescue groups can do the microchips now. As far as tracking them you can't call them up and pin point the dogs exact location, but if someone does pick up your dog for some reason, then they take them to a facility to get them checked for a chip. The facility will scan the dog for a chip and their scanner will get the chips number and they can put it into a database and it'll pull up all the contact info that's been registered with that chip number.
